Does the name marlene have a story behind it?

Origin: Germanic

Meaning: "Little Maria"

Background: The name Marlene is a feminine name that is derived from the Germanic name "Mariam", which is a combination of the names Maria and Magdalene. Maria is a Latin form of the Hebrew name Miriam, which means "sea of bitterness" or "wished-for child". Magdalene is derived from the Aramaic word 'Migdol', which means "tower".

Historical Impact:

- In the 19th century, Marlene was used as a diminutive for Maria and Magdalena, but it gradually became a standalone name.

- Its popularity grew significantly during the early 20th century, particularly due to the rise of German actress Marlene Dietrich, who became a symbol of glamour and sophistication in the 1930s.

- The name Marlene continued to be popular in various countries throughout the 20th century, and it remains in use today, although its usage has declined somewhat in recent years.
